A fluoropolymer-lined diaphragm valve is a corrosion-resistant shut-off/regulating valve with a fluoroplastic (such as PTFE or FEP) lining inside the valve body (flow channel and sealing surface) and fitted with a fluoropolymer diaphragm. The flow channel is opened or closed by the raising or lowering or squeezing of the diaphragm.

The fluoropolymer lining and the fluoropolymer diaphragm together isolate the medium from the valve body substrate (mostly cast iron or carbon steel), preventing corrosion. It boasts advantages such as "strong corrosion resistance," "no dead-angle sealing," and "zero media contamination," conforming to GB/T 12239 and HG/T 4084 standards. It is widely used in chemical, metallurgical, and pharmaceutical industries for conveying corrosive media such as strong acids, alkalis, and organic solvents.

Fluorine-Lined Diaphragm Valve Structure and Principle

Diaphragm Isolation

A soft diaphragm made of rubber or fluoroplastics (such as PTFE, FEP) completely isolates the internal cavity of the valve body from the driving components (such as the valve stem and valve disc). The driving components move the valve stem via compressed air, electricity, or manual operation, causing the diaphragm to rise, fall, or compress, thus opening or closing the flow path and preventing contact between the medium and metal parts.

Fluorine Lining Protection

The inner wall and flow path of the valve body are lined with fluoroplastics (such as PTFE, PFA), forming a corrosion-resistant barrier. The fluoroplastic lining layer has a uniform thickness (2-5mm) and is tightly bonded to the substrate, resisting the erosion of highly corrosive media such as hydrochloric acid, sulfuric acid, and nitric acid.
